Software Engineering Manager
Ashley Home Stores, Ltd.
Tampa, United States of America
yesterday
Role details
Contract type
Permanent contract Employment type
Full-time (> 32 hours) Working hours
Regular working hours Languages
English Experience level
IntermediateJob location
Tampa, United States of America
Tech stack
Flutter
JavaScript
API
Amazon Web Services (AWS)
Data analysis
Automation of Tests
Azure
C Sharp (Programming Language)
Mobile Application Development
Code Review
Continuous Integration
Database Design
Software Debugging
DevOps
Github
Google Analytics
Node.js
NoSQL
PCI Data Security Standards
Performance Tuning
Scrum
Software Architecture
Systems Development Life Cycle
Power BI
Svelte
Next.js
SAP Applications
Shopify
Software Engineering
SQL Databases
TypeScript
Web Content Accessibility Guidelines
Web Applications
Web Application Frameworks
Web Usability
Link Control Protocol
React
Grafana
Technical Debt
Backend
Cloudformation
Adobe
Gitlab-ci
Material Design
Kubernetes
Cloudflare
Free and Open-Source Software
GraphQL
React Native
Front End Software Development
Multiaccess Edge Computing
Software Coding
REST
Terraform
Docker
Jenkins
Microservices
Job description
Position Overview: We're seeking a hands-on Engineering Manager to lead an engineering team (frontend, full-stack, QA) while remaining actively involved in technical delivery. This role balances strong technical expertise with proven leadership experience, requiring 20-30% hands-on coding alongside strategic team management., Team Leadership
- Lead and mentor a team of engineers (frontend, full-stack, QA)
- Build high-performing teams through hiring, onboarding, and professional development
- Conduct 1:1s, performance reviews, and career development planning
- Manage team capacity, sprint planning, and resource allocation
- Foster collaboration, innovation, and engineering excellence
Hands-On Technical Contribution
- Actively contribute code to critical features (20-30% of time)
- Lead code reviews and provide technical guidance
- Design and architect scalable frontend and full-stack solutions
- Debug complex issues and prototype new technologies
- Drive technical decisions and proof-of-concepts
Engineering Operations
- Optimize SDLC for speed and quality
- Implement and improve CI/CD pipelines
- Establish engineering metrics (velocity, quality, deployment frequency)
- Lead incident response and post-mortems
- Drive best practices in testing, deployment, and monitoring
Technical Strategy
- Define technical roadmap and architecture
- Make technology stack decisions
- Balance technical debt with feature delivery
- Ensure scalability, performance, and reliability
- Collaborate with Product, Design, and Analytics teams
Requirements
Leadership Experience
- 3+ years managing engineering teams (frontend, full-stack, QA)
- Proven track record hiring, developing, and retaining talent
- Successful delivery of complex, multi-team projects
Technical Experience
- 8+ years as individual contributor in frontend/full-stack development space
- Expert-level proficiency in JavaScript/TypeScript
- Modern frontend frameworks: Svelte/SvelteKit (required or willing to learn), React/Next.js (required)
- Full-stack development:
- Backend: Node.js, or C#
- RESTful APIs and/or GraphQL
- Database design (SQL and NoSQL)
E-Commerce & PWA
- Salesforce Commerce Cloud (SFCC) experience:
- SFCC architecture and APIs (SCAPI, OCAPI)
- SFCC PWA Kit or headless commerce
- Business Manager configuration (preferred)
- Progressive Web App (PWA) expertise:
- Service Workers, offline functionality
- Core Web Vitals optimization (LCP, FID, CLS)
- Mobile-first development
- Performance optimization and Lighthouse
DevOps & Cloud
- CI/CD: GitHub Actions, Jenkins, GitLab CI, or Azure DevOps
- Containerization: Docker, Kubernetes
- Cloud platforms: AWS, Azure, or GCP
- Infrastructure as Code: Terraform, CloudFormation
- Monitoring: Grafana, PowerBI
Other Requirements
- Strong understanding of software architecture and design principles
- Experience with test automation (TDD, unit, integration, e2e)
- Agile/Scrum methodology expertise
- Analytics implementation experience (GA4, Amplitude, etc.)
- Performance optimization and security best practices
- Distributed team management experience
Preferred Qualifications
- Salesforce Commerce Cloud certifications
- Headless/composable commerce architecture experience
- E-commerce platform experience (Shopify, Adobe Commerce, SAP)
- Micro-frontends or microservices experience
- CDN/edge computing knowledge (Fastly, Cloudflare)
- Mobile development (React Native, Flutter)
- Design systems and component libraries
- Accessibility standards (WCAG)
- PCI compliance and e-commerce security
- Open-source contributions
Benefits & conditions
Benefits We Offer
- Health, Dental, Vision, Employee Assistance Program
- Paid Vacation, Holidays, and Your Birthday off
- Generous Employee Discount on home furnishings
- Professional Development Opportunities
- Ashley Wellness Centers (location specific) and Medical Tourism
- Telehealth
- 401(k) and Profit Sharing
- Life Insurance
Our Core Values
- Honesty & Integrity
- Passion, Drive, Discipline
- Continuous Improvement/Operational Excellence
- Dirty Fingernail
- Growth Focused
About the company
About Ashley: Ashley is a global leader in furniture manufacturing and retail. Our technology team drives digital transformation, developing cutting-edge e-commerce solutions serving millions of customers worldwide. We're building modern, scalable platforms that redefine the furniture shopping experience.